Violet Eyes by Elizabeth Taylor is a Floral fragrance for women. Violet Eyes was launched in 2010. The nose behind this fragrance is Carlos Benaïm. Top note is Peach; middle notes are Rose and Jasmine; base notes are Virginia Cedar, Peony and Amber. Elizabeth Taylor launches her new fragrance Violet Eyes in April 2010. This sensual perfume is inspired by her iconic eye color; it is feminine, captivating, sophisticated and intriguing. Filled with a bouquet of the flowers Elizabeth Taylor loves, the composition is both modern and mysterious. Top note is composed of fresh white peach, followed by the floral heart of jasmine and purple rose. Wonderful peony, amber and cedar form the long-lasting base of the fragrance. It is available as 50 ml EDP.
